摘要
Unenhanced, non-resonant Raman spectra of a H-terminated vicinal Si(111) surface, Si[6(111)-(1 ($) over bar 1 ($) over bar 2)], with dihydride-terminated bilayer steps have been measured. All four Si-H stretches (and a approximate to 4% ML kink-defect mode) can be observed if both the excitation and detection geometries are favorable. A method for extracting the orientation of adsorbates using polarized, angle-resolved Raman scattering is presented. Assuming the C-1 mode corresponds to a localized Si-H stretch, the step dihydride is found to be rotated 37 +/- 4 degrees away from the surface normal. This value is in agreement with recent ab initio cluster calculations.
